Using any Quick unit will speed up the casting time of any TECHNIC, but not the actual animation. It reduces that little charge time where your character looks like it's concentrating before it finally throws the spell out. That means it may not show too much of a difference for something that casts quickly like Foie and Barta, but for a fully developed Gi spell you'll notice a big difference.
